Fallon Sherrock will be part of the line-up at the 2020 UK Open at Butlins, Minehead after claiming victory in a Riley's Amateur Qualifier held on Saturday in Wolverhampton.
Sherrock became the
first woman to win a match at the PDC World Championship in December and will be part of the World Series in
all events; as well as the
Premier League in nearby Nottingham in just over two weeks time.
Despite that, it was the different surroundings of Rileys for the Milton Keynes ace with 200 players involved; she won through to the board final where she took on James Richardson; who faced Mikuru Suzuki at the recent PDC World Championship; it was Sherrock who prevailed 4-0.
She was joined in the semi-finals as a result by Stuart White, Ant Allen and experienced player Paul Rowley. The latter was awaiting her in the semi-final; she eased past Rowley 4-1 to get into the final against White.
White won the bull and went one nil up in the best of nine match but Sherrock didn't drop a leg from there easing through 5-1 just before midnight to confirm her place in Minehead. She will join Lisa Ashton in the field who of course qualifies as part of the 128 PDC Tour Card holders.
